Absolute 50 Fly

First ever flybridge from Absolute

Absolute can build a quality sportscruiser, that’s a fact, so we can’t wait to see how they tackle a flybridge design when the first Absolute 50 Fly hits the water in September.

Looks wise, the Absolute DNA is plain for all to see, dashing lines combine with the slick hull windows, which look like they’ve been lovingly carved out of the GRP, to create a genuinely eye-catching boat.

We’re not so sure about what appears to be a fixed flybridge ‘roof’ but it will at least provide shelter from the elements.

Interestingly, the band wagon has been left well alone and Absolute have gone for a more traditional layout with the master cabin forward and twin and double master cabins amidships, the latter being ensuite.

It looks from the drawings like the master ensuite, the shower unit especially, infringes on space in the galley but we will have to reserve judgment until we get on board the boat and have a poke around.

With the galley down layout there should be plenty of space left in the saloon for loafing and eating.

Standard engine options are twin IPS600s but a triple installation can be specified if you regularly feel the need for speed.
